  • Antibody Specificity
    This antibody is specific for the Slick antigen in both mice and rats. This antigen is a channel that can produce an outward rectifier K+ current.
  • Application Supplier Note
    This antibody was used for immunopercipitation on mouse synaptic plasma membranes (Rizzi et al., 2015; PMID: 29124216) (Rizzi et al, 2016; PMID:26587966). The antibody has also been shown to be useful in western blot (Rizzi et al., 2015; PMID: 29124216) (Rizzi et al., 2016; PMID: 26587966). This antibody can be used for immunofluorescense on the brain of a mouse (Rizzi et al., 2015; PMID: 29124216). Immunohistochemistry can be done on mouse brain using this antibody (Rizzi et al., 2016; PMID: 26587966) (Li et al., 2017; PMID: 28660246).
